US’ Ball Corp. to build aluminum can plant in Pennsylvania

It was reported that Ball Corp. has planned to build a new aluminum can plant in Pittston, Pennsylvania, and the initial investment exceeded US$300 million.

The aluminum can plant was scheduled to start production in mid-2021. It was expected that 230 job vacancies will be created.

The plan was to fulfill the increasing requirement of aluminum cans for beer, wine, water, and other canned drinks.
